summaryrefslogtreecommitdiffstats
path: root/meta/packages/meta
diff options
context:
space:
mode:
authorRichard Purdie <richard@openedhand.com>2007-11-12 16:28:59 +0000
committerRichard Purdie <richard@openedhand.com>2007-11-12 16:28:59 +0000
commit755bf7803826ef1d7139fcd776f342e7c08a9014 (patch)
treeef7179982e16e7e0a15c55059f832265b81f7e5b /meta/packages/meta
parentef0256ead0816f361f1a6fe774b2bb3a48a91f82 (diff)
downloadpoky-755bf7803826ef1d7139fcd776f342e7c08a9014.tar.gz
meta-toolchain: Fix some paths and remove unneeded header file manipulation
git-svn-id: https://svn.o-hand.com/repos/poky/trunk@3129 311d38ba-8fff-0310-9ca6-ca027cbcb966
Diffstat (limited to 'meta/packages/meta')
-rw-r--r--meta/packages/meta/meta-toolchain.bb11
1 files changed, 3 insertions, 8 deletions
diff --git a/meta/packages/meta/meta-toolchain.bb b/meta/packages/meta/meta-toolchain.bb
index b6705e0a53..2f913eaefb 100644
--- a/meta/packages/meta/meta-toolchain.bb
+++ b/meta/packages/meta/meta-toolchain.bb
@@ -51,19 +51,14 @@ do_populate_sdk() {
51 fi 51 fi
52 done 52 done
53 53
54 mv 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/gcc* ${SDK_OUTPUT}/${prefix}/lib 54 mv 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/gcc ${SDK_OUTPUT}/${prefix}/lib
55
56 cp -pPR ${TMPDIR}/cross/${TARGET_SYS}/include/linux/ 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/include/
57 cp -pPR ${TMPDIR}/cross/${TARGET_SYS}/include/asm/ 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/include/
58 chmod -R a+r 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/include/
59 find 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/include/ -type d | xargs chmod +x
60 55
61 echo 'GROUP ( libpthread.so.0 libpthread_nonshared.a )' > 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/libpthread.so 56 echo 'GROUP ( libpthread.so.0 libpthread_nonshared.a )' > 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/libpthread.so
62 echo 'GROUP ( libc.so.6 libc_nonshared.a )' > 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/libc.so 57 echo 'GROUP ( libc.so.6 libc_nonshared.a )' > ${SDK_OUTPUT}/${prefix}/${TARGET_SYS}/lib/libc.so
63 58
64 # remove unwanted housekeeping files 59 # remove unwanted housekeeping files
65 mv ${SDK_OUTPUT}${libdir}/../${TARGET_SYS}/lib/ipkg/status ${SDK_OUTPUT}/${prefix}/package-status 60 mv ${SDK_OUTPUT}${prefix}/${TARGET_SYS}/lib/ipkg/status ${SDK_OUTPUT}/${prefix}/package-status
66 rm -Rf ${SDK_OUTPUT}${libdir}/ipkg 61 rm -Rf ${SDK_OUTPUT}${prefix}/${TARGET_SYS}/lib/ipkg
67 mv ${SDK_OUTPUT}/usr/lib/ipkg/status ${SDK_OUTPUT}/${prefix}/package-status-host 62 mv ${SDK_OUTPUT}/usr/lib/ipkg/status ${SDK_OUTPUT}/${prefix}/package-status-host
68 rm -Rf ${SDK_OUTPUT}/usr/lib 63 rm -Rf ${SDK_OUTPUT}/usr/lib
69 64